The Logitech G Cloud game console is now also available in Finland. Developed in collaboration with Tencent Games, the device is capable of high-performance gaming using wireless LAN.
With the lightweight, portable game console, you can play games by streaming games from the Xbox cloud service with an Xbox Game Pass subscription, or alternatively using cloud services that enable PC gaming, such as Nvidia GeForce Now or Shadow PC Service that brings your computer to the cloud.
The console can stream games from your own Xbox game console to the Xbox application or Steam service with the SteamLink function. Games can also be downloaded to the console from the Google Play Store. In addition, the game console is suitable for viewing video streams.
G Cloud features 1080p resolution touchscreen with 60Hz screen refresh and 16:9 aspect ratio. Battery life is promised to be 12 hours, and the game console weighs 463 grams.
The game console can also be customized as per the requirements of the user. For example, all physical buttons on a game console can be defined to act at specific points on its screen. In this case, the buttons simulate the operation of a touch screen in games where a traditional controller is not used. You can also adjust the sensitivity of the directional controls. In addition to these, the sensitivity of the triggers can be determined by setting the so-called dead zone.
